Behold I’m making all things new

I sign the cross with unmarked hands,

a sign to contradict myself:

opposing all my own demands,

a remedy against my health.

 

These hands, unmarred by easy ways,

are quick to grasp against the loss

of all the shades that will not stay

beneath the shadow of the cross.

 

O Dreaded Heart conscripting me,

Your love is wrapped in bloodied silk!

You call to shoulder willingly

the burden I would gladly bilk!


And so I trace each wound anew

— a prayer transfixing me to you.
